一、综合开发环境(IDE)
Visual Studio 微软出品,支持C、C++、Python、Java等多种语言,集成调试、版本控制等功能,适合大型项目开发。
优势:跨平台、插件丰富(如SQL Server工具、AI辅助编程)。
PyCharm
JetBrains开发,专注Python开发,提供智能代码补全、调试器、单元测试工具,支持Django等框架。
优势:社区活跃、文档完善,适合数据科学和机器学习项目。
Eclipse
开源平台,支持Java、C/C++、PHP等语言,插件生态丰富(如AStyle代码美化、CVS版本控制)。
优势:高度可定制,适合长期项目开发。
二、数据库管理工具
MySQL Workbench
专为MySQL设计,提供数据库设计、建模、性能优化功能,界面直观,适合数据库管理员。
SQL Server Management Studio (SSMS)
微软出品,集成数据库管理、分析工具,支持SQL Server数据库操作。
三、代码分析与调试工具
Visual Studio Code (VS Code)
轻量级编辑器,支持实时代码检查、调试,插件扩展性强,适合前端/后端开发。
JetBrains ReSharper
用于C开发,提供代码重构、智能提示功能,提升开发效率。
GDB (GNU Debugger)
开源调试工具,支持C/C++程序调试,适合深入分析代码问题。
四、学习与辅助工具
Codecademy
在线平台,提供互动式编程课程,涵盖Python、JavaScript等语言,适合初学者。
LeetCode & HackerRank
用于算法练习,提供海量编程题库,支持代码验证。
Docker & Kubernetes
容器化开发工具,帮助构建、部署应用,适合微服务架构开发。
五、其他专业工具
Xcode: 苹果官方开发工具,支持iOS、macOS应用开发,集成模拟器与调试功能。 Blender
选择建议 语言专项